(1) USE PERMIT APPLICATION UP-2-10, by the City of Redding, requesting approval to allow an encroachment into the 100-year floodplain of the Sacramento River associated with improvements to the existing South Bonnyview Road boat-launch facility on property located at 3855 South Bonnyview Road in a "PF" Public Facilities District. Environmental Determination: Categorically Exempt. Staff Recommendation: Approval. L-010-390 APPROVED
(2) RECOMMENDATION TO THE CITY COUNCIL - REZONING APPLICATION RZ-4-10, by the City of Redding, requesting approval to amend Zoning Code Chapter 18.31 to establish a base density of 20 units per acre for housing developments that are affordable to lower-income households in the "RM-12," "RM-15," and "RM-18" Districts, if those projects "reserve" at least 35 percent of their units for lower-income households. Environmental Determination: Addendum to the Mitigated Negative Declaration prepared for the Zoning Code. Staff Recommendation: Recommend to the City Council adoption of the Addendum and approval. L-010-230 RECOMMENDED ADOPTION OF THE ADDENDUM AND APPROVAL
(3) RECOMMENDATION TO THE CITY COUNCIL - FINAL ENVIRONMENTAL IMPACT REPORT EIR-1-08, prepared for the Salt Creek Heights Subdivision/Planned Development project (Project). The Project consists of a proposal to divide approximately 273 acres for the development of 440 residential units, a 13.9-acre public park, and retention of open space (S-15-07). The Project also includes Rezoning Application RZ-6-07 and Planned Development Plan PD-11-07, to apply the "PD" Planned Development Overlay District to the property, and a Development Agreement. The Project site is generally located north of Eureka Way (SR 299) and west of Buenaventura Boulevard at the western city limits. Staff Recommendation: Recommend to the City Council adoption of EIR-1-08. L-010-075 RECOMMENDED CERTIFICATION OF THE EIR
(4) RECOMMENDATION TO THE CITY COUNCIL - SALT CREEK HEIGHTS SUBDIVISION/PLANNED DEVELOPMENT PROJECT (PROJECT), by Sierra Pacific Industries, on property generally located north of Eureka Way (SR 299) and west of Buenaventura Boulevard at the western city limits. Environmental Determination: Environmental Impact Report. The project consists of the following applications:
▸ Tentative Subdivision Map Application S-15-07, Salt Creek Heights Subdivision. Subdivide property to create 440 residential units of mixed housing types, which include 248 standard single-family units, 96 clustered garden-court single-family units, and 96 apartment units. S-101-135
▸ Planned Development Plan Application PD-11-07, Salt Creek Heights Planned Development Plan. A planned development request to allow single-family residential lots in an "RM" Residential Multiple Family District and lot-size and configuration exceptions to accommodate the various housing styles and to establish overall project-design parameters. L-010-211-043
▸ Rezoning Application RZ-6-07. Rezone the entire Project site to apply the "PD" Planned Development Overlay District. L-010-230
▸ Salt Creek Heights Development Agreement. An agreement between the Project Applicant and the City, allowing credit against the Project’s park-development fee obligations in exchange for construction of a public neighborhood park as a component of Project development. The Agreement also addresses off-site sewer improvements and the project approval period. S-101-135
Environmental Determination: Accept EIR-1-08. Staff Recommendation: Recommend to the City Council approval of the Project. RECOMMENDED APPROVAL
